Mkhwebane notified Ramaphosa in May that he was implicated in her investigation for violating the Executive Ethics Code.
Mkhwebane’s investigation is linked to a donation to Ramaphosa’s campaign for the ANC presidency from controversial businessperson, Gavin Watson. Ramaphosa received the Section 7 notice from Mkhwebane in May but requested an extension due to “other pressing matters of state”. In his statement, Ramaphosa reaffirmed his respect for the office of the public protector and his commitment to offer his full cooperation.”
